A fire affecting a fryer, range or extraction canopy can stop a commercial kitchen long after the flames are out. The immediate clean-up is only part of the problem. Equipment may be unsafe to use, the extraction system may require inspection, insurers may need evidence, and a missed service can quickly become lost revenue and reputational damage. Knowing how to reduce kitchen fire downtime means planning for prevention, rapid suppression and controlled recovery before an incident tests your operation.
How to reduce kitchen fire downtime before an incident
The quickest recovery is usually the incident that never develops beyond its earliest stage. In commercial kitchens, cooking oils, grease deposits, high temperatures and continuous service create a fire risk that cannot be managed by general precautions alone. Fire risk assessments, safe working procedures and staff training are essential, but they need to be supported by protection designed for the cooking line.
A properly specified kitchen fire suppression system detects or responds to a fire at the point of risk and discharges a wet chemical agent over the affected appliances. It is designed to cool burning oil and create a seal that helps prevent re-ignition. Where correctly integrated, the system can also shut down fuel or electrical supplies and interface with extraction equipment as required by the design. This limits the spread of fire and can reduce the extent of damage to the kitchen.
The specification matters. A system must protect the actual risk, not a generic version of it. Appliance type, fuel source, canopy layout, ductwork, cooking methods and future changes to the line all affect nozzle placement and system configuration. An under-specified installation may leave gaps in protection. An unnecessarily disruptive installation can create avoidable operational issues. A specialist survey should identify both the fire risk and the practical requirements of the site.
Maintenance is equally important. A system that has not been inspected, serviced or adjusted after equipment changes cannot be assumed to perform as intended. Keep service records available, ensure access to protected equipment is not obstructed, and tell your maintenance provider before adding, moving or replacing fryers, grills or ranges. Small layout changes can have a significant effect on coverage.
Keep grease from turning a small fire into a major closure
Grease is often the factor that extends kitchen fire downtime. Deposits on filters, canopies and within ductwork can allow fire to spread beyond the original appliance, increasing damage, contamination and the time needed to make the area safe.
A documented cleaning regime should reflect how the kitchen actually operates. A high-volume frying operation will need more frequent attention than a lightly used daytime kitchen. Do not rely on a schedule copied from another site. Review production volumes, cooking practices and visible grease build-up, then record cleaning and extraction maintenance so there is a clear audit trail for management, enforcing authorities and insurers.
Daily checks also have value. Staff should be able to identify damaged filters, excessive grease around appliances, unusual extraction performance, overheating equipment and combustible packaging stored too close to the cookline. These are practical checks, not paperwork for its own sake. They help prevent the conditions that turn a contained appliance fire into a wider incident.
Train for the first two minutes, not just the annual induction
When a fire starts, hesitation and incorrect intervention add to downtime. Staff need clear, role-specific instructions that can be followed under pressure. They should know how to raise the alarm, evacuate customers and colleagues, call the fire and rescue service, isolate the area where it is safe to do so, and never use water on cooking oil or fat fires.
Training should also explain what happens when the automatic suppression system operates. Once agent has discharged, staff must not restart equipment or resume cooking simply because the visible flames have stopped. The affected appliances, fuel isolation and electrical systems need to be checked and the system must be restored by a competent provider before the protected cooking line returns to service.
Short, regular refreshers are more effective than treating fire response as a forgotten induction topic. Include agency staff, kitchen porters and shift leaders, particularly in businesses with high staff turnover or extended trading hours. A straightforward notice near the cooking line can reinforce the key actions, but it is not a substitute for practical instruction.
Build a recovery plan that protects safe trading
Every commercial kitchen should decide in advance who does what after a suppression discharge or fire. Without that plan, operators can lose hours locating key contacts, debating whether equipment can be used, or waiting for information that should already be available.
Your plan should name the responsible manager, the suppression maintenance provider, extraction contractor, insurer or broker, landlord where relevant, and emergency equipment contacts. Store system documentation, servicing certificates, appliance details and photographs of the normal cookline in an accessible place away from the kitchen. This helps establish what was affected and supports a quicker assessment.
After an incident, the priorities are normally to:
- keep people clear of the affected area and follow emergency procedures;
- preserve the scene and record the event, including photographs where safe and appropriate;
- arrange inspection, cleaning and reinstatement by competent contractors; and
- communicate clearly with staff, customers and delivery partners about any change to service.
The order can vary. If the fire is limited and the system has contained it, part of the operation may be able to continue from unaffected equipment once it is confirmed safe. In other cases, smoke, heat or agent contamination may require a full temporary closure. The objective is not to reopen at any cost. It is to return to safe, compliant trading as soon as the evidence supports it.
Design protection around your trading hours
Installation work should not create the disruption that the fire protection system is meant to prevent. For busy restaurants, hotels, care settings and production kitchens, closing the cookline during peak periods is rarely realistic. A specialist installer should plan surveys, installation and commissioning around the working kitchen wherever possible, with clear agreement on access, isolation requirements and handover.
It is also worth considering what happens outside normal opening hours. Many fires start during cleaning, preheat, late preparation or when a fault develops after staff have left. A suppression system provides continuous protection for the designated cooking risk, but it should form part of a wider fire strategy that includes suitable detection, alarm arrangements, housekeeping and maintenance.
Third-party interfaces need particular care. Where the suppression system shuts off gas, electricity or activates other controls, every interface should be tested during commissioning and recorded. Poorly managed interfaces can delay recovery because the fire system may work, yet an appliance, gas supply or extraction control does not reset as expected. This is one reason to use a provider with direct experience of integrated commercial kitchen systems rather than treating suppression as an isolated purchase.
Work with insurers before there is a claim
Insurer requirements can influence the protection standard expected for a commercial kitchen, especially where there is deep-fat frying, solid-fuel cooking, large extraction systems or high property values. Leaving this discussion until after an incident can create unnecessary uncertainty about cover, reinstatement and business interruption.
Provide your insurer with current details of the cooking risk, extraction cleaning arrangements, suppression system certification and maintenance records. If you are refurbishing the kitchen or changing the menu in a way that alters cooking methods, review the fire protection at the same time. A new appliance may increase production capacity, but it can also change the fire load and invalidate assumptions made under the previous system design.

Downtime is reduced by decisions made well before a fire starts. Keep the cooking line clean, make sure the suppression system matches the risk, train people for a real emergency, and agree the recovery process while service is running normally. Those measures give your team the best chance of protecting people, property and the ability to trade when it matters most.
